缓存服务器的基本概念
缓存服务器, 顾名思义,就是存储数据的临时存储地方。它的基本上作用是改善网络的性能、节省带宽阔、搞优良数据访问速度,以及少许些原始数据源的负载。
缓存服务器的干活原理
缓存服务器通过存储频繁访问的数据副本,少许些了对原始数据源的需求。当用户求数据时缓存服务器先说说检查其本地存储是不是有所需的数据。如果有, 则直接返回数据;如果没有,则向原始数据源发起求,获取数据并存储在本地,以便后续用户飞迅速访问。
缓存服务器的类型
缓存服务器基本上分为以下几种类型:
- 直接缓存:存储用户频繁访问的来自Internet服务器的Web对象。
- 反向缓存:存储由服务器生成的数据,如API调用后来啊。
- 本地缓存:存储在用户设备上的缓存数据。
- 代理缓存:位于用户和原始服务器之间的缓存,用于存储和分发内容。
缓存服务器的优势
缓存服务器具有以下优势:
- 少许些网络传输延迟:通过存储数据副本,缓存服务器能少许些用户访问数据所需的时候。
- 搞优良连接速度:缓存服务器能缓存一巨大堆数据,从而加迅速用户访问速度。
- 节省带宽阔:缓存服务器能少许些对原始数据源的需求,从而节省带宽阔。
- 搞优良可用性:即使原始服务器停机或不可达,缓存服务器仍然能给数据访问。
缓存服务器的应用场景
缓存服务器在以下场景中:
- Web缓存:存储频繁访问的Web页面和对象,搞优良网站访问速度。
- 云计算:缓存虚拟机实例和应用程序,搞优良材料利用率。
- 巨大数据琢磨:缓存一巨大堆数据,搞优良数据处理速度。
- 移动应用:缓存离线数据,搞优良应用性能。
Cache-aside与Cache-as-SoR模式
缓存服务器基本上有两种模式:Cache-aside和Cache-as-SoR。
- Cache-aside模式:在读取数据时检查缓存, 如果缓存命中则返回数据,否则从原始数据源获取数据并更新鲜缓存。
- Cache-as-SoR模式:在写入数据时更新鲜缓存,然后异步更新鲜原始数据源。
缓存服务器的以后进步趋势
因为手艺的不断进步, 缓存服务器将在以下方面取得更许多突破:
- 智能缓存:根据用户行为和访问模式,自动调整缓存策略。
- 边缘计算:将缓存服务器部署在边缘网络,搞优良数据访问速度。
- 许多云缓存:支持跨优良几个云平台的缓存服务。
缓存服务器作为数字时代的加速器, 在搞优良数据访问速度、少许些原始数据源负载等方面具有显著优势。因为手艺的不断进步,缓存服务器将在以后发挥更巨大的作用,为数字时代的进步注入更许多活力。